Description
This school is also known locally as “the little school” and although the façade is predominately native rock, the entry has a more “modern” appearance with concrete and the rock work is rather spare as compared with the more elaborate rock work at the Scopus school. The entry goes into the school between the 2 floors with the whole school below the level of the street. It is one of many stone schoolhouses in Bollinger County and the largest along with the Lutesville school.
